正畸学中的软组织激光:概述

Soft-tissue lasers in orthodontics: an overview.

作者信息

Kravitz Neal D, Kusnoto Budi

机构信息

Kravitz Orthodontics, Chantilly, Virginia 20152, USA.

出版信息

Am J Orthod Dentofacial Orthop. 2008 Apr;133(4 Suppl):S110-4. doi: 10.1016/j.ajodo.2007.01.026.

DOI:10.1016/j.ajodo.2007.01.026
PMID:18407017
Abstract

Soft-tissue lasers have numerous applications in orthodontics, including gingivectomy, frenectomy, operculectomy, papilla flattening, uncovering temporary anchorage devices, ablation of aphthous ulcerations, exposure of impacted teeth, and even tooth whitening. As an adjunctive procedure, laser surgery has helped many orthodontists to enhance the design of a patient's smile and improve treatment efficacy. Before incorporating soft-tissue lasers into clinical practice, the clinician must fully understand the basic science, safety protocol, and risks associated with them. The purpose of this article is to provide an overview regarding safe and proper use of soft-tissue lasers in orthodontics.
